Gers are mad for Madjid

RANGERS have been linked with a £2million summer move for Charlton central defender Madjid Bougherra.

The Algerian international has been outstanding at The Valley since signing from Guegnon 18 months ago.

Addicks boss Alan Pardew has rejected a £1.6m bid from Real Betis for the 25-year-old but Gers could swoop.

Reports in England suggest Walter Smith wants to bring Bougherra to Ibrox as a possible partner for Carlos Cuellar at the hearts of Gers' defence.

Portsmouth, Wigan, Newcastle and Middlesbrough are also keen on the centre-back who has had spells with Crewe and Sheffield Wednesday.

Charlton chairman Martin Symons told MailSport: "So far we have not received any offer from Rangers for Madjid.

"The manager is on holiday at the moment and I don't expect anything to happen until he has returned."
